The Brief

These three homes were created to balance refined architecture with highly functional living. The project responds to its urban context, integrating layered landscaping and generous glazing.

Each home is thoughtfully planned to enhance everyday liveability, with light-filled kitchens and sculleries, improved ventilation strategies, and flexible ground-floor spaces that can adapt to changing needs. Split-level moments and feature stair elements are explored to add architectural interest while improving spatial flow and ceiling heights.

One residence takes advantage of its prominent corner position with an elevated roof terrace, envisioned as an outdoor retreat for entertaining and enjoying potential views. Across all three homes, the design focuses on passive design principles, privacy, and long-term comfort, resulting in a cohesive yet individually considered collection of residences.
